The GridSmith crossword generator exposes a single endpoint that accepts a word list, grid dimensions, and an optional theme seed, and returns a completed puzzle with clue slots. Requests are rate-limited to thirty per minute per credential, and malformed grids return a structured error rather than a partial puzzle. As a contractor you will use the staging environment only; production access requires a separate review. All staging requests authenticate against the internal Puzzleforge service. For your initial testing, use the key below.

gateway credential: zpat15_lMLOSdhT94y0U3l

# Data Stores — Velmara User Module Split

The user module is being carved out of the Velmara monolith into its own service, `velmara-identity`. Profile, credential, and session tables have been copied to a dedicated cluster; the monolith retains read-only views until cutover. Release 4.2 flips dual-writes on, and 4.3 removes the legacy tables. Replication lag alerts route to the platform channel. For cutover verification, the release manager should confirm the identity service connects to the new cluster with the following connection string.

replica DSN, yahaf-yagaf: mongodb://tamath_svc:a2netSk3RZMuTj@db-d084.novacsoft.internal:5432/ralmir

// MAX_BATCH_KEYS caps how many translation strings the Lexigram
// extraction script processes per run. If the nightly job stalls,
// it's almost always because a merge dumped thousands of new keys
// and the batch exceeded this cap. Bump it temporarily, rerun, then
// revert. Before paging the localization team, confirm the run
// matches the extractor build token below.

session token of bagag-fafop = htk21_cbc501024a787b9031ac6